Have a personal or library account? Click to login
Excel and the World Wide Web Straight to the Point Cover

Excel and the World Wide Web Straight to the Point

Mastering Web Data Extraction in Excel with VBA, Selenium, and Power Query

Paid access
|Dec 2024
Product purchase options

Learn to automate web data extraction in Excel using VBA, Selenium, and Power Query. Master static and dynamic queries, JSON parsing, and browser automation, tackling modern web challenges seamlessly.

Key Features

  • Practical techniques for web-to-Excel integration using VBA, Selenium, and Power Query
  • Clear solutions for handling modern web challenges, including browser limitations and JSON data
  • Comprehensive coverage of static queries, dynamic queries, and advanced browser automation

Book Description

This book is a comprehensive guide for integrating web data into Excel, ideal for both beginners and experienced users. It begins by introducing essential concepts like HTML and JSON, laying the foundation for web data extraction. Readers start by performing static and dynamic web queries directly in Excel, building confidence in handling foundational tasks.
As the journey continues, the book explores advanced automation using VBA and Selenium. Readers learn to interact with web elements, handle authenticated requests, and navigate modern challenges like working with iframes, downloading files, and creating PDFs. Key techniques, including using XPath and CSS selectors, are explained to streamline data extraction. Chapters also address overcoming VBA’s limitations with modern browsers like Microsoft Edge, providing practical solutions.
In the final chapters, Power Query is introduced as a powerful tool for connecting and transforming web data. Readers explore both direct and advanced methods to integrate Excel with web sources efficiently. By the end, readers will master practical workflows, combining VBA, Selenium, and Power Query to automate and simplify web data extraction in Excel.

What you will learn

  • Perform static and dynamic web queries directly in Excel
  • Automate browser interactions with Selenium and VBA
  • Extract and parse JSON data for web-based Excel workflows
  • Integrate Power Query to manipulate and load web data efficiently
  • Handle authenticated web requests and modern browser challenges
  • Apply advanced XPath and CSS selectors for precise data scraping

Who this book is for

This book is designed for data analysts, Excel enthusiasts, and developers who need to integrate web data with spreadsheets. A basic understanding of Excel and VBA is required, while prior experience with Power Query or Selenium is helpful but not mandatory.

Table of Contents

  1. Getting Started
  2. Interacting with Sites without using a Browser
  3. Internet Explorer and VBA
  4. Introducing Selenium
  5. Google Chrome and VBA
  6. Microsoft Edge and VBA
  7. Power Query and the Web
  8. Conclusion
https://packt.link/3p1TC
PDF ISBN: 978-1-83702-310-3
Publisher: Packt Publishing Limited
Copyright owner: © 2024 Packt Publishing Limited
Publication date: 2024
Language: English
Pages: 58